However, you need to be careful when assessing someone else's nonverbal … WebBody Language or Body Movements (Kinesics) Body movements include gestures, posture, head and hand movements or whole body movements. Body movements can be used to reinforce or emphasise what a person is saying and also offer information about the emotions and attitudes of a person.

Body language contains 10 subsets, which can be remembered by the sentence, "Pat Goes Ape", where each letter stands for an element of body … high country real estate brian head utahWebBody language may take two forms of unconscious movements and consciously controlled movements. For example; When a person is bored, he may gaze around the room rather than look at the speaker or he may shift positions frequently. When a person is nervous, he may bite his nails or mash hair. These are usually made unconsciously. high country real estate burney caWeb26 apr. 2024 · Body language is the use of physical behaviour, expressions, and mannerisms to communicate non-verbally.
